Power-One stock falls on revised Q1 guidance
Shares of Power-One Inc. (Nasdaq: PWER) fell in after-hours trading today after the power conversion products manufacturer issued lowered revenue guidance for the first quarter ended March 31.
Camarillo, Calif.-based Power-One said its North American business did not achieve anticipated forecasts.
The company will release full results on May 1. It then expects to report a net loss of about $0.14 per share on revenue of $124 million.

The following small-cap companies were making news in after-hours trading Wednesday:
Avici Systems Inc. (Nasdaq: AVCI) plunged $3.04, or 22.5%, to $10.50 on unusually heavy volume after the routing systems provider announced plans to transition away from core router development to focus on its new product initiative, Soapstone Networks. The company also announced a special dividend of $2 per share and released its first quarter financial results, which included a profit of $6 million, or $0.42 a share.
